Marker's F10 Tour is an ideal entry level touring binding that can offer years of great performance. Focusing on producing the right binding for the end user is Marker's DNA. For the skier who wants a very light all-day touring setup with solid all-mountain performance, the Tour 10 features a DIN range of 3-10, making it a great choice for lighter weight skiers. Compatible to all kinds of alpine and touring boots, thanks to Sole.ID! The Climbing Aid works with 0°, 7° and 13° for relaxed uphill climbing in any angle. SOLE.ID - One binding, two boot norms - Whatever boot you wear, all Marker SOLE.ID bindings are compatible to every kind of ski boot! Whether you prefer alpine boots or boots with touring sole, with SOLE.ID the bindings can be adjusted in seconds. The secret is the height-adjustable gliding plate; easy to handle and of course providing uncompromising performance. SOLE.ID respects ISO 5355 (alpine boots) and ISO 9523 (boots with touring soles). HOLLOW TECH - Our fibre-reinforced frame base plate provides impressive riding stability and is yet very light due to the gas injected hollow construction. BACKCOUNTRY COMFORT - The patented, ergonomically shaped lever under the boot allows comfortable opening and closing. The position prevents the binding from unwanted release and provides unparalleled security against an undesired "telemark" situation. AFD STAINLESS STEEL - All MARKER bindings are equipped with a moveable AFD (anti friction device) leading to a highly precise release almost entirely unhindered by dirt, snow and ice! Individual adjustment of the AFD to the area of application ensures perfect functionality - from racing, for children's bindings or on ski tours. CLIMBING AID - The titanium climbing aid offers two positions with 7° and 13° which can easily be accessed with the ski pole, even in an unstable standing position. Integrated elastomer paddings dampen the impact reducing the irritating traditional "clack" and allow more comfortable hiking. - Brake width: 90mm - Length adjustment: 265 – 325mm (Short), 305 - 365mm (Long)

The Free 7 is Marker's all-purpose Junior freeskiing binding, featuring a 95mm brake for all-mountain oriented junior twin-tips and mid-fat junior skis. Its toe and heel designs allow compatibility with both adult and junior boot lug designs. AFD GLIDING PLATE - MARKER bindings are equipped with a movable AFD (anti-friction device) supporting a precise release almost entirely unhindered by dirt, snow, and ice! Individual adjustment of the AFD to the area of application enhance optimized functionality - from racing, for children’s bindings, or on ski tours. GRIPWALK THE SOLE-BINDING SYSTEM FOR BETTER WALKING COMFORT AND TOP SKIING PERFORMANCE - GripWalk contains a new co-polymer sole with a rocker profile. The convex shape and ribbed tread of the rubber add a lot of walking comfort and provide a much better grip. Still, integrated pads made of stiff and rigid materials, enable great power transmission and a more precise release function of the binding. GripWalk soles are the perfect tuning parts designed for selected premium ski boots and bindings. COMPACT HEEL - A statement of efficiency - with the usual optimized MARKER release properties and the perfect mix of great design, lightness, and excellent functionality. This heel technology is perfect for beginners and occasional skiers due to improved release properties and is an excellent value. BIOTECH - During a backward twisting fall, both horizontal and vertical forces are triggered on the toe of the binding. Biotech recognizes this unfavorable force combination and reliably reduces the release force.

The SPX 12 GripWalk Binding Is a High-Performance Freeride Binding For Aggressive Skiers. The combination of a Full Action toe piece and SPX heel deliver the longest elastic travel on the market for unmatched shock absorption. The result is instant power transmission and precise control with superior shock absorption to reduce unwanted pre-release. It's compatible with traditional Alpine (ISO 5355) and GripWalk boot soles. Look's SPX heel design offers 27mm of elastic travel for best-in-class shock absorption, confident retention, and a significant reduction in unwanted prerelease. An oversize heel pivot increases coupling strength (boot-binding interface) for more efficient power transmission. Long Elastic Travel - Longer elastic travel ensures more reliable retention to keep you in when you need. LOOK bindings offer the most elastic travel (lateral and vertical) and the fastest re-centering prior to release, ensuring superior shock absorption to reduce unwanted pre-release. Rolling Control - LOOK binding components are designed to deliver industry-leading roll coupling strength (boot-to-binding interface). This ensures minimal roll before the boot engages the binding for the most efficient power transmission in skiing. GripWalk GRIPWALK compatible bindings ensure perfect compatibility with two boot sole standards: - Traditional Alpine soles (ISO 5355) - GRIPWALK soles (future ISO 23223 standard) Full Action Toe Piece - Featuring 45mm of elastic travel and 180° multi-directional release, the FULL ACTION toe piece delivers best-in-class retention and release and increased coupling strength (boot-to-binding interface) for maximum power transmission. Multi-Directional Release - LOOK is the only binding brand to develop a true mechanical upward release that functions independently from the heel for the most effective 180° MULTI DIRECTIONAL RELEASE in the instance of a fall. - Brake Width: 90 - 100mm - Weight: 1110g 1/2 Pair - DIN/ISO: 3.5-12
